Horse Treats
£29.67
Horse Treats
£7.02
Horse Treats
£18.33
Horse Treats
£18.33
Horse Treats
£29.67
Horse Treats
£7.02
Horse Accessories
£5.03
Horse Accessories
£22.28
Horse Accessories
£22.28
Horse Accessories
£22.28
Horse Accessories
£22.28
Horse Accessories
£22.28
Horse Accessories
£10.80
Horse Accessories
£10.80
Horse Accessories
£10.80
